PURA Enters $39 Billion Market Acquiring CBD Sexual Wellness Business


DALLAS, June 25, 2020 /PRNewswire/ -- Puration, Inc. (USOTC: PURA) today announced the acquisition of a CBD infused sexual wellness product line. The global sexual wellness market is anticipated to reach a $39 billion value by 2024.  This acquisition makes PURA's fourth acquisition this year.  Management plans to publish a comprehensive update on the company's overall acquisition campaign next week on Tuesday, June 30, 2020.

PURA's revenue is generated today primarily through the sales of its EVERx CBD Sports Water.  PURA reported $2.7 million in annual sales last year and $800,000 in the first quarter of 2020.  In January of this year, PURA initiated an acquisition campaign to acquire CBD infused beverage, edible and topical businesses. 

Forbes reports that vertically integrated hemp and CBD companies capitalized under $6 million are at risk of not surviving the economic conditions resulting from COVID-19. The challenges facing such companies creates a target rich acquisition market.

In conjunction with the acquisition campaign, PURA secured a $5 million investment to fund its acquisition efforts.  The acquisition today was secured with a royalty agreement and a commitment for PURA to fund a marketing expansion of the product line.  Learn more about PURA's overall acquisition and expansion initiative next week on Tuesday, June 30, 2020.
